Just how much does the underground economy cost when it comes to the iPhone? Quite a bunch, we suspect, judging by how folks who develop applications for jailbroken iPhones are squabbling to be the top earner in this market. Among these names include Installous, Hackulous and Mega who are currently having some mud-wrestling sessions among each other. For example, Hackulous came up with a free app that enables one to download pirated iPhone apps, while Mega released a similar service with a subscription fee model - $9.99 monthly, $23.99 for each quarter or $41.99 for half-yearly. The folks at Hackulous were not happy with this due to the charges involved, and in turn released Grabulous that allows free access to all Mega apps. Sorta like a beef that benefits owners of jailbroken iPhones, eh?
